Subject: [PATCH v3 net-next 06/14] net_sched: cake: use qdisc_pkt_segs()

Use new qdisc_pkt_segs() to avoid a cache line miss in cake_enqueue()
for non GSO packets.

cake_overhead() does not have to recompute it.
